Amid the COVID-19 pandemic, Hapag-Lloyd faced significant supply chain challenges, prompting the need for improved supplier insights. In 2021, the company partnered with Craft, a supply chain technology firm, to enhance transparency through a supplier intelligence platform. This tool allows Hapag-Lloyd to gather critical data on suppliers, assess risks, and respond quickly to disruptions, such as a recent strike affecting East Coast ports. The platform's features enable the company to adapt schedules and monitor geographical and regulatory risks, ensuring reliable service delivery to customers.
